The FBI dubbed it a€?Operation Varsity Blues,a€? a nationwide university admissions bribery and cheating conspiracy that guaranteed college students would get into their particular desired schools, if their moms and dads comprise ready to shell out a hefty cost.
But William a€?Ricka€? Singer, the California college admissions consultant who orchestrated the scheme, described it as a a€?concierge servicea€? in a conversation secretly recorded by the FBI and played for jurors Tuesday at the federal trial of two parents accused of paying Singer to get their children into top-tier schools as fake athletic recruits.
a€?We help the wealthiest individuals in america obtain toddlers into school,a€? Singer told a York lawyer who had been seeking services for their daughter throughout the June 2018 telephone call. Ignorant the FBI were tipped to his program and stolen their cellular phone, performer boasted which he got the go-to man for virtually any NBA and NFL employees manager and had aided 761 people go android casino into college through the a€?side door,a€? a process he had produced for people who a€?want assurances.a€?
Singer advised the lawyer the guy charged $250,000 to $500,000 for their entrance strategy, and also for another $75,000 could have a proctor inflate their daughtera€™s SAT get. That plan, the guy said, ended up being a€?the room run of home runs.a€?
